In the field of classic signal processing, sound waves can be constructed from sine waves, whose frequency corresponds to the pitch in the sound. Anyone who has studied Fourier transform will know that this information can be used to write the sound into a combination of sine waves:

That is, just start with a sine wave with amplitude 1, then multiply the sine wave by the appropriate loudness factor, and then add these sine waves together. The sum of all different sine waves with amplitude 1 is "white noise".

According to the geometric Langlands program, the characteristic layer functions like a sine wave. Dennis identified something named the Poincare layer, which functions like "white noise". However, Dennis does not know whether he can combine each

The feature layers are all represented in the Poincare layer.
